View raw sorry about that, but we cant show files that are this big right now. Nov 20, 2017 find out how to import and export excel in asp. You only need to add a reference in your project to the file. This site uses cookies for analytics, personalized content and ads. Hssf namespace allows you to manipulate xls file format, while npoi. Best 20 nuget excel packages nuget must haves package. This is to have intellisense, etc in visual studio. One or more nuget packages need to be restored but couldnt be because consent has not been granted. Keywords excel, npoi, office, word license apache 2. Net library that creates advanced excel spreadsheets without the need of interop. For more information about nuget, visit the codeplex project site. In this example we create a input file for upload the excel and after uploading it append the excel data into div and then download that excel and also create a excel file using dummy data and export for same. Net core web application with razor pages and retrieve data from sql server using entity framework, you can visit my previous article below are the softwareconcepts used in. An archive of the codeplex open source hosting site.
Last week i was working on exporting data to excel and csv format in aspnet core and i want to share the technique how i did it. You must be wondering if there is an easy way to work on excel in the. Export and import excel data using npoi library in. Net cli paket clir direct download installpackage npoi dotnet add. It allows developers to convert excel to other popular formats, such as pdf, xml, html, csv, image format, etc. Neuzilla provides commercial software customization and consulting service. Instead of it, we are going to use some third party component. The npoi and sharplibzip dependencies have been updated to versions 2.
Now that we know what npoi is going to provide us, lets go grab the files well need to get started. Microsoft excel is a program developed by microsoft for windows, andriod, ios, and macos. To achieve this currently i am trying to use package manager npoi nuget. Here, i am going to use npoi library file, which was available in nuget package manager. In this article, we are going to learn how to read the uploaded excel file without using microsoft. Find out the service status of and its related services. More often, we need to develop an export to excel feature in our applications, many of us usually create boring string builder, then convert it to excel or use interop or itextsharp or npoi or something else to achieve the same result. Best way to include all library related to npoi is nuget package manager. This api is used by the nuget client in visual studio, nuget. Most downloaded package versions top 500 community packages over the last 6 weeks show all packages the packages with the most downloads. It needs microsoft office suite installed on your server which is. Aug 10, 2019 the npoi library provides us easy control while dealing with the office excel file.
Top excel libraries in 2017 nuget must haves package. Now that we know what npoi is going to provide us, lets go grab the. The legacy socalled applications like excel or word are no more legacy and can be used on any platform using simple libraries like npoi etc. Dec 16, 20 this is an article for just writing an excel file using npoi and i want the quickest and easiest way to export a excel file from mvc. Core package which is an unofficial port of eeplus library to. You can also give consent by setting the environment variable. Here i am going to talk about a very simple approach of using openxml sdk from microsoft which is free and opensource.
Net library for reading and writing microsoft office binary and ooxml file formats. Keywords npoi, xls, excel, xlsx, word, docx, biff, dotnetcore, openxml, poi license apache 2. Getting started with npoi 3 introduction 3 examples 3 installing npoi 3 create a excel file 4 reading a excel file 4 chapter 3. Filehelpers download get the last version of the library. Net, for building apps that run on linux, macos, and windows. The extensions of npoi, which provides ienumerable save to and load from excel. Once you have met the prerequisites, you can manually download the repository from github or install from nuget. With npoi, you can readwrite office 20032007 files very easily.
Open the downloaded executable location in the command window, and run the following commands to download and install the required nuget packages to a project specified in the nfig. This is the 2nd post of a series of posts about npoi 2. Dependencies 3 dependent packages 91 dependent repositories 28 total releases 7 latest release oct 7, 2019 first release aug 18, 2017. Read posted excel file using npoi library in asp mvc with ajax. Myget hosting your nuget, npm, bower, maven, php composer, vsix, python, and ruby gems packages. We are using npoi library here, which will help to perform import and export operations. Net library for spreadsheets read, write excel xls. Then, execute the following command to install the npoi. We are using npoi dll for this export which is free to use, refer to npoi nuget for more details. Net programmers to create as well as modify word processing from their own. Install npoi from nuget installpackage npoi version 2.
I downloaded the latest build from codeplex, but it was still on a 1. In a command window enter the command set systemroot and press enter. Now epplus has released beta package which supports. Exceldna eases the development of excel addins using. Below are the softwareconcepts used in this document. Using the excel pia primary interop assemblies to generate a spreadsheet serverside. The nuget client tools provide the ability to produce and consume packages. We also have some other third party components exceldatareader etc. Net cli to perform nuget operations such as dotnet restore, search in. Net core web application with razor pages and retrieve data from sql server using entity framework, you can visit my previous article. Npoi apache poipoor obfuscation implementation microsoft documents java api. I am using visual studio 2017 most updated version and asp. Troubleshooting nuget package restore in visual studio. In this article, we will see different ways to export data to excel from a web application.
Jul 03, 2018 last week i was working on exporting data to excel and csv format in aspnet core and i want to share the technique how i did it. Net library to read and write microsoft office file formats formats. Addins created with exceldna can export highperformance userdefined functions and macros, and can be packed into a single file for easy distribution and installation. To keep everything in work fluid motion i will keep the user on the same page and do a forced download within that page. The npoi library provides us easy control while dealing with the office excel file. The nuget gallery is the central package repository used by all package authors and consumers. The nuget team does not provide support for this client. Npoi is a free tool which supports xls, xlsx and docx extensions.
Today we learned, how to import and export data tofrom excel in. Read the frequently asked questions about nuget and see if your question made the list. Net framework, nuget makes it easier and faster for programmers. Nov 05, 2015 in this article, we will see different ways to export data to excel from a web application. To give consent, open the visual studio options dialog, click on the nuget package manager node and check allow nuget to download missing packages during build. Nuget is the package manager for the microsoft development platform including. Getting started with apachepoi 2 remarks 2 versions 2 examples 2 installation or setup 2 chapter 2. Nov 20, 2012 the tools package contains the open xml sdk v2.
337 1186 1413 915 904 1500 1193 367 998 1179 819 905 1635 131 138 715 150 1669 1261 393 1007 217 825 408 826 1363 1024 576